Transaction daf13989d7bd0542a92e9cd5ec3b5e0fc93f7a6d48702d27e245885039dabe92
1 Input
1 Output
-
daf13989d7bd0542a92e9cd5ec3b5e0fc93f7a6d48702d27e245885039dabe92:0
- value
- 890000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ff8f9e580cd35b6e5f4148ad05a952583eea3220 OP_EQUAL
- address
- 3QzJHFWaHdKEmQtbxTg27JEfsSomUtuvHk